Quick Fix: Someone Still Loves You Boris Yeltsin - Let It Sway

[Released on Polyvinyl]
Words: Gareth O’Malley
We can’t help but wonder if Boris Yeltsin was ever aware of this band’s existence. If he had been, would he have approved of the name? It’s one of those questions that will never be answered - thanks to the ex-Russian President’s death in 2007.
We like it though. It seems to be a little like Marmite. We can certainly see why. However, you can’t argue with that artwork, and most would struggle to find fault with the Missouri quartet’s brand of sprightly indie-pop.
There is nothing complex about what these guys do, but then again there doesn’t need to be, as they have a wonderful ear for melody and a great way with a tune, as songs like the album highlight ‘My Terrible Personality’ show to great effect.
There are more subdued moments here, of course, like ‘Stuart Gets Lost Dans Le Metro’, a great song that relies only on piano and acoustic guitar, but for the most part this is an uptempo, upbeat, uplifting listen. This is most certainly a return to form after the uneven sophomore record ‘Pershing’. ‘Back In The Saddle’? You’re telling me.
